Abstract
Tetracapsuloides bryosalmonae (Myxozoa) is the causative agent of proliferative kidney disease in various species of salmonids which are found in Europe and North America. Less information about the interactions of T. bryosalmonae proteins with salmonid proteins during parasite development is known. In this study, anti-T. bryosalmonae monoclonal antibody-linked to N-hydroxysuccinimide-activated spin columns were used to purify parasite and host proteins from the kidneys of infected and non-infected brown trout (Salmo trutta) Linnaeus, 1758. The samples were next analyzed by electrospray ionization coupled to mass spectrometry to identify proteins that may be involved in the infection and proliferation of T. bryosalmonae within the brown trout host. A total of 6 parasite proteins and 40 different host proteins were identified in this analysis. The identified host proteins function in various processes, which include host defense, enzymatic, and structural components. In conjunction with modern molecular based tools, such siRNA, gene replacement, or gene disruption, this data can ultimately be used to develop novel control methods for T. bryosalmonae, based on the proteins or pathways identified in this study.Entities:

Malacosporean parasite proteins identified in the kidneys of brown trout infected with Tetracapsuloides bryosalmonae
| Protein description | Accession number | Mass (Da) | Score | Matches | Coverage (%) |
|---|---|---|---|---|---|
| Actin | gi|148491610 | 31449 | 90 | 6 | 18.7 |
| Histone H3 | gi|148491585 | 18822 | 84 | 6 | 9.4 |
| Histone H2B | gi|148491596 | 18828 | 25 | 2 | 5.1 |
| Hypothetical protein | gi|148491565 | 17407 | 28 | 2 | 5.7 |
| Glyceraldehyde-3-phosphate dehydrogenase | gi|148492233 | 34089 | 24 | 2 | 2.2 |
| Small nuclear ribonucleoprotein D1 polypeptide 16 kDa | gi|148491909 | 32913 | 29 | 2 | 1.7 |

Fig. 2Tetracapsuloides bryosalmonae stages in kidney tissues of brown trout, Salmo trutta. a Intra-luminal sporogonic stages of parasite (arrows) and proliferation of the interstitial tissue can be seen in the kidney of brown trout. Tubule lumen filled with numerous intra-luminal sporogonic stages of the parasite. b Non-infected kidney of brown trout. Parasite stages were visualized by immunohistochemistry using anti-T. bryosalmonae monoclonal antibody and counterstained with hematoxylin
